International Physics Olympiad held in Turkmenistan

The 5th International Physics Olympiad, organized in a digital format, took place at the Seyitnazar Seydi Turkmen State Pedagogical Institute.

This high-level international event brought together about 380 students from higher educational institutions not only of Turkmenistan, but also from 14 countries around the world, including the Russian Federation, the United States of America, the People’s Republic of China, Italy, Romania, Belarus, the Republic of Türkiye, Uzbekistan, Tajikistan, Pakistan, India, Kyrgyzstan, Kazakhstan, and Azerbaijan. It should be noted that the organization of such competitions has become a good tradition on the eve of the celebration of the International Day of Neutrality, and this year's Olympiad is dedicated to a significant occasion — the 30th anniversary of the recognition by the United Nations General Assembly of Turkmenistan’s permanent neutrality.

The fact that in the year of the wide celebration of the 30th anniversary of the Motherland’s neutrality the number of participating countries increased to 14 (previously the competition involved representatives from 8 countries) testifies to the steady growth in the popularity of this international Olympiad. The increase in the number of participants is also due to the preparation of tasks in three languages — Turkmen, English, and Russian.

The scientific competition demonstrated the high level of preparation of all its participants. A clear confirmation of this is that 19 students achieved the highest results. High scores were awarded to students of Magtymguly Turkmen State University, Ufa State Petroleum Technological University, Seyitnazar Seydi Turkmen State Pedagogical Institute, Nizami Tashkent State Pedagogical University, Xinjiang University (PRC), Tajik National University, Belarusian State University, Aba Annayev International Horse Breeding Academy (Turkmenistan), the University of Memphis (USA), Azerbaijan Technical University, and L.N. Gumilyov Eurasian National University.
